Transaction bc68fc7d25d5cefbf4d5b79daf12cf9d436891dde3ef98035173a025b00a5b7c
1 Input
1 Output
-
bc68fc7d25d5cefbf4d5b79daf12cf9d436891dde3ef98035173a025b00a5b7c:0
- value
- 16407183
- script pubkey
- OP_0 OP_PUSHBYTES_20 013c15f73d0f8ee5e22c99aafc0087516068d72a
- address
- bc1qqy7ptaeap78wtc3vnx40cqy829sx34e2c3fhkc